In the summertime of 1973, Stax recording star Johnnie Taylor was making among the sweetest soul music, and his followers have been lapping it up. He was already climbing the R&B and pop charts along with his newest hit single “I Believe In You (You Believe In Me),” which was on its method to gold certification and the highest of the soul bestsellers. Now got here the brand new album, Taylored In Silkthat may proceed Taylor’s scorching streak.

On July 14, 1973, Johnnie entered the pop LP chart with the file, which might keep on the countdown till late November. Broadly thought to be one among, if not one of the best album of his Stax years, it contained not solely “I Believe” however two extra future hits that may preserve him on R&B radio for months to come back.

They have been the cool, finger-snapping “Cheaper To Keep Her” and the dishonest ballad “We’re Getting Careless With Our Love.” The later, remastered model of the album turned it right into a veritable hits bundle, because it added Johnnie’s 1972 hits “Standing In For Jody” and “Doing My Own Thing,” and even one from 1971, “Hijackin’ Love.”

With manufacturing by Don Davis, string preparations by Wade Marcus and the gruffly soulful Taylor in nice kind, the album was an actual winner. Hear particularly for his model of the Clyde Otis music most intently related to Dinah Washington, “This Bitter Earth.”

‘Pleasing to the senses’

“Beautifully controlled and pleasing to the senses,” raved Billboard of Taylor’s LP. “A magnetic vibrancy characterizes his singing on what are largely love-oriented ballads. The prevailing atmosphere is warm and glowing. His virile vocalizations find suitable augmentation through the Muscle Shoals Rhythm Section.” It’s an album that exhibits Johnnie Taylor to be one of many best, and nowadays maybe one of the vital underrated, soul males of his time.
